Spanish figure skater Laura Barquero tested positive for doping during the recent Beijing Winter Olympics, the International Testing Agency (ITA) announced on Tuesday.
«The ITA informs that the sample taken from the Spanish skater Laura Barquero Jiménez has given an adverse analytical result for the prohibited substance Clostebol metabolite 4-chloro-3Î-hydroxy-androst-4-en-17-one, according to the List Banned from the World Anti-Doping Agency (WADA),” the ITA statement said.
The sample was collected under the testing authority of the International Olympic Committee (IOC) in an anti-doping control carried out on February 18, during the pairs skating short program.
“The athlete has been informed of the case. She has the right to request B-sample analysis,” the ITA said in a statement, adding that the matter will be referred to the Anti-Doping Chamber of the Court of Arbitration for Sport. Barquero, 20, and his partner Marco Zandron finished 11th in pairs figure skating.
